Subject: DR drill — Quickfind autocomplete index

Hi,

As part of Thursday's disaster-recovery drill at Brindlecote Systems, we will deliberately fail over the Quickfind autocomplete index, which has been rebuilding slowly since the shard split. Please observe latency during replay and note any gaps for your review. To restore the standby index, the operator enters the recovery passphrase below.

unlock words, kagef-taduf: fenir-quenix-norwyn-sorvan-gormir-gorir-fraok

Subject: New key cabinet for pool cars

Night shift,

A new key cabinet for the pool cars has been installed beside the security desk at Arlenwick House, replacing the drawer system. Each key hook is numbered to match the bay numbers in the undercroft. Please log every key out and back in the night register, including times, and report any missing fobs before 06:00 handover. The cabinet lock accepts the access code below.

turnstile pass: bdg-FVNQRS-72965873

The total adjustment is approximately 410,000, booked in Q2. Causes include overestimated seasonal demand and a supplier quality issue that rendered one batch unsellable. Department heads should update their shrinkage forecasts accordingly and route disposal requests through the standard clearance process. No external communication is authorized. The commercial context driving this decision is recorded below.

internal memo for hafog-hadug: The pricing group signed off on a budget of $16.1 million for Project Gorir. The renewal with Oliionax Systems closes at $14.1 million a year, 46 percent above the last contract.